Finding, Understanding, and Applying Research Evidence in Practice
Jennifer Bredemeyer, Ida Androwich, Heather E. McKinney, Kathleen Mastrian, and Dee McGonigle
OBJECTIVES
1. Explore the acquisition of previous knowledge through Internet and library holdings.
2. Examine information fair use and copyright restrictions.
3. Assess informatics tools for collecting data and storing information.
4. Evaluate evidence-based practice and translational research.
5. Describe models for introducing research findings into practice.
6. Identify barriers to research utilization in practice.
